{"page":"\u003clink rel=\"stylesheet\" href=\"https://lessonplanet.com/assets/packs/css/resources-c03aa079.css\" /\u003e\n\u003clink rel=\"stylesheet\" href=\"https://lessonplanet.com/assets/packs/css/lp_boclips_stylesheets-517835be.css\" media=\"all\" /\u003e\n\u003cdiv data-title='Source of Haiti cholera bug goes under microscope' data-url='/boclips/videos/5c54ba70d8eafeecae11d7c5' data-video-url='/boclips/videos/5c54ba70d8eafeecae11d7c5' id='bo_player_modal'\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='boclips-resource-page modal-dialog panel-container'\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='react-notifications-root'\u003e\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-header'\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-type'\u003e\n\u003ci aria-hidden='true' class='fai fa-regular fa-circle-play'\u003e\u003c/i\u003e\nVideo\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003ch1 class='rp-title' id='video-title'\u003e\nSource of Haiti cholera bug goes under microscope\n\u003c/h1\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-actions'\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='mr-1'\u003e\n\u003ca class=\"btn btn-success\" data-posthog-event=\"Signup: LP Signup Activity\" data-posthog-location=\"body_link_boclips\" data-remote=\"true\" href=\"/subscription/new\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003e\u003cspan\u003eGet Free Access\u003c/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"\"\u003e for 10 Days\u003c/span\u003e\u003cspan\u003e!\u003c/span\u003e\u003c/span\u003e\u003c/a\u003e\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-body'\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-info'\u003e\n\u003cdiv aria-label='Hide resource details' class='rp-hide-info' role='button' tabindex='0'\u003e\u0026times;\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003ci aria-label='Expand resource details' class='rp-expand-info fai fa-solid fa-up-right-and-down-left-from-center' role='button' tabindex='0'\u003e\u003c/i\u003e\n\u003ci aria-label='Compress resource details' class='rp-compress-info fai fa-solid fa-down-left-and-up-right-to-center' role='button' tabindex='0'\u003e\u003c/i\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-rating'\u003e\n\u003cspan class='resource-pool'\u003e\n\u003cspan class='pool-label'\u003ePublisher:\u003c/span\u003e\n\u003cspan class='pool-name'\u003e\n\u003cspan class='text'\u003e\u003ca data-publisher-id=\"30356011\" href=\"/search?publisher_ids%5B%5D=30356011\"\u003eCurated Video\u003c/a\u003e\u003c/span\u003e\n\u003c/span\u003e\n\u003c/span\u003e\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class='rp-description'\u003e\n\u003cspan class='short-description'\u003eAs Haiti continues to grapple with a cholera epidemic that broke out months after the massive 2010 earthquake, findings from a new study once again bring into focus the controversial question of what caused the outbreak.The study...\u003c/span\u003e\n\u003cspan class='full-description hide'\u003eAs Haiti continues to grapple with a cholera epidemic that broke out months after the massive 2010 earthquake, findings from a new study once again bring into focus the controversial question of what caused the outbreak.\u003cbr/\u003eThe study published in the journal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ences challenged the view that the United Nations was responsible for bringing the deadly disease to Haiti. \u003cbr/\u003eAccording to the study, led by a University of Maryland cholera expert, Haiti had not just one cholera strain, but a second one that may have been lurking undetected prior to the arrival of a United Nations peacekeeping battalion from Nepal.\u003cbr/\u003eMany have blamed the Nepalese battalion for bringing the disease that has sickened more than half a (m) million people. \u003cbr/\u003e\"It's clear that the bacterium wasn't in this country: we never had any cases. Even with the country's problems in sanitation and its broken sanitation, we never had this disease,\" said Joceline Brunache Pierre-Louis, a doctor with the Haitian Health Ministry. \u003cbr/\u003eAt a treatment centre overseen by Doctors Without Borders in Port au Prince, dozens of patients suffering from cholera receive care. \u003cbr/\u003eThere are no hard numbers on the number of people who are currently sick. \u003cbr/\u003eBut Haitian health officials say more than 7,300 people have died and more than 574-thousand others have fallen ill since the 2010 outbreak.\u003cbr/\u003eThe new report argues that a \"definitive statement\" about the source of the outbreak cannot yet be made, and calls for the creation of a public database to study cholera strains.\u003cbr/\u003eIt states that a \"perfect storm\" of environmental circumstances in 2010 enabled the bacteria to appear, as the impoverished country was hit by a massive earthquake, a hurricane and a very hot summer.\u003cbr/\u003eThe disease came about soon after the quake.\u003cbr/\u003e\"It pops out of nowhere, and now you have it in epidemic levels. So obviously just that alone is interesting enough to say OK, we need to study this,\" said Chad Weber, a research assistant at the University of Florida Emerging Pathogen Institute.\u003cbr/\u003eWeber is working at the Public Health Laboratory in Gressier, trying to determine the current status of the epidemic in that area. \u003cbr/\u003eHe said the researchers were \"looking at the environment, we are looking at stool samples, we're looking at the built environments, roadways and buildings where waters sources are, and using all that to meld together a comprehensive view of what's going on with cholera.\" \u003cbr/\u003eCholera, whose symptoms consist of rapid dehydration and vomiting, is spread through water or food contaminated by the bacterium - easily in Haiti because the country lacks a proper sewage and sanitation system.\u003cbr/\u003eIn November 2010, a week of anti-UN riots broke out when suspicions were first raised that the Nepalese UN peacekeepers had brought the disease with them to the island. \u003cbr/\u003eUN Secretary General Ban Ki-moon ordered an investigation and the resulting report revealed that there was a \"perfect match\" between cholera strains found in Haiti and Nepal, but it avoided pinning blame. \u003cbr/\u003eThe UN is at the centre of a legal complaint even though it enjoys immunity in Haiti and other countries because of a Status of Forces Agreement. \u003cbr/\u003eThe outcome could change the way the UN missions can be held legally accountable.\u003cbr/\u003eThe new report's findings have met plenty of scientific resistance. \u003cbr/\u003eMany scientists say the second cholera strain cited by the report was unlikely to have caused the outbreak because it's nontoxic, naturally inhabits bodies of water around the world and is unlikely to trigger epidemics. \u003cbr/\u003eUnlike the strain that sickened so many Haitians, this one is believed to cause only mild diarrhoea and isn't life-threatening.\u003cbr/\u003ePort au Prince - Recent\u003cbr/\u003e1.
